Finding Reliable Industrial Chemical Distributors in [Your Region]
Securing a trustworthy supply of industrial chemicals is here vital for any business in [Your Region]. Identifying a truly reliable distributor can be challenging , but here's how to approach the process. Begin by researching potential partners online, utilizing directories like IndustryNet and searching for local supplier listings. Don’t just look at websites; read customer feedback carefully. Ensure that the distributor is properly licensed and insured, which demonstrates their commitment to safety and regulatory compliance. Consider factors beyond price – evaluate their inventory selection, delivery capabilities (including speed & reliability), technical support offered, and overall customer service. It’s often beneficial to request references and speak directly with existing clients about their experience. Finally, prioritize distributors who demonstrate a strong understanding of your specific industry needs and offer custom solutions if required.

Optimizing Your Chemical Inventory with Bulk Purchasing Options
Managing a chemical stockpile can be complex, particularly for labs and businesses that frequently utilize various substances. Explore leveraging bulk purchasing options to significantly reduce costs and streamline your procurement process. Buying chemicals in larger quantities often unlocks substantial savings , minimizing the per-unit price and potentially lowering overall expenses. However, it’s crucial to carefully assess storage capacity, shelf life, and usage rates before committing to a large acquisition; otherwise, you risk waste or products expiring. Evaluate supplier relationships, investigate available packaging sizes, and perform a thorough demand forecast to ensure a successful chemical bulk purchasing strategy that optimizes both your budget and operational efficiency .
The Role of Distributors in the Fine Chemical Landscape
Distributors play a critical role within the specialty chemical industry , acting as a bridge between producers and end-users. They offer several benefits including localized supply, technical support , and often, smaller package sizes than manufacturers typically provide. This facilitates customers – frequently in the coatings or flavorings industries – to access a diverse portfolio of chemicals without requiring large minimum orders . Furthermore, distributors often possess targeted insight regarding local regulations and market demands , providing invaluable advice to their customer base. They are a essential part of the supply chain, fostering productivity and flexibility across the entire chemical landscape.
